What is Vibe Coding with Wispr Flow?
Vibe coding with Wispr Flow is a novel method of programming where developers use voice dictation alongside AI-generated code to create software applications. Instead of manually writing every line of code, developers simply describe their high level idea or functionality in plain language. Wispr Flow’s AI assistant interprets these natural language prompts and generates code snippets in various programming languages such as Python, JavaScript, or React components. For example, a user might say "create a function that sorts a list of numbers," and Wispr Flow will provide the created Python code for that functionality. This process streamlines coding by reducing the need for manual typing and copy paste stuff, making it easier to develop software quickly and efficiently. Vibe coding describes a chatbot-based approach to creating software where the developer uses natural language prompts to generate code. The software, scripts, or code created through this process demonstrate how the term ‘vibe coding’ emphasizes that the hottest new programming language is English, highlighting the reliance on natural language for coding prompts.

Challenges and Considerations When Using Wispr Flow for Vibe Coding
While vibe coding with Wispr Flow offers exciting possibilities, challenges remain. Speech recognition must accurately interpret natural speech, including unique words and technical programming terminology. Users can customize the AI handle to improve recognition of specific words or technical terms, ensuring the AI transcribes them correctly and enhances workflow accuracy. The AI’s output requires careful review to ensure correct syntax and functionality. Spoken input is transformed into written code or commands, so it is important to verify that the written output matches the developer's intent. Developers must balance reliance on Wispr Flow’s AI-generated code with their expertise to avoid errors and maintain code quality. Critics of vibe coding point out potential risks, including security vulnerabilities and lack of maintainability in AI-generated code. Some tasks, such as detailed debugging or complex algorithm design, may still require traditional manual coding. A key aspect of vibe coding is that users accept AI-generated code without fully understanding it. The developer does not review or edit the code generated by vibe coding, but evaluates it through tools and execution results.
